Boat “Navire Amadeus” with Wi-Fi in Sète
Located in Sète, the Navire Amadeus offers a unique 40 m² accommodation for up to 11 guests. On this historic vessel, you’ll find 3 bedrooms and 3 bathrooms. Each room has its own TV, Wi-Fi, and heating. Breakfast is included with your stay. Please note that the kitchen is not accessible and there are no cooking facilities available.
The boat is moored at the quay, close to Sète’s city center, making it easy for you to explore the picturesque canals and lively port.
One pet is allowed on board. Parties and events are not permitted. Please respect basic safety rules on board; access is via a stable and secure gangway.
Launched in 1910, the Amadeus is one of the oldest boats in Sète’s port. It has been renovated over the years while preserving the spirit of an old sailing ship. Enjoy walks along the canals, discover Mont Saint-Clair, the Quartier Haut, and the vibrant harbor. Experience the beaches, water jousting, and local specialties like Bouzigues oysters, Frontignan muscat, and fresh tielles in an authentic, sunny atmosphere inspired by the songs of Georges Brassens.
